It is a Perl-based open source tool specially developed to migrate schema, data from Oracle databases to PostgreSQL and understands both databases very well and can migrate any size data. PostgreSQL is a great choice for migration, offering advanced features, high performance, rock-solid data integrity, and a flexible . Unfortunately, Ora2Pg isn't a single tool you just download, install and start to use. $37 million WHITEPAPER You can study the current schema and state of database architecture to conduct assessments for migration. Accelerate Oracle to Aurora PostgreSQL Migration (GPSTEC313) - AWS re:Invent 2018. Get a clear picture of your current situation, the architecture of your existing applications, the challenges you are facing and your business goals. Ora2pg. Database Migration: Challenges of Migration from Oracle to Open Source Maurizio De Giorgi (EMBL-EBI) Monitoring Amazon RDS and Aurora with Percona Monitoring and Management Mykola . Method 2: Using Hevo Data to Set up Oracle to PostgreSQL Migration. I am working on a migration from Oracle to PostgreSQL using the AWS SCT. Use Tools. This tutorial is part of a series that shows you how to migrate a database from Oracle to Cloud SQL for PostgreSQL. PostgreSQL community adds new features and improving existing features on an ongoing basis. The Amazon Schema Conversion Tool helps convert your existing database schema from one database engine to another. It is considered to be one of the top database choices when customers migrate from commercial databases such as Oracle and Microsoft SQL Server. 8. Now, right click and click "Convert schema". Sizing for any migration project is quite difficult, and can be especially difficult when the migration target is a different database engine. Select Connect to Oracle. The service supports homogeneous migrations such as . When architecting a new Aurora/Postgres environment for an Oracle migration, one of the first difficulties most clients encounter is appropriately sizing the environment. Postgres. we helped one of our clients to save with Oracle to PostgreSQL migration. There are various reasons to migrate a database from Oracle to AWS PostgreSQL. It will generate a file called output.sql containing the commands to create the schema in PostgreSQL. The steps and the details are similar for both migration paths. 14 8. Enter values for Oracle connection details in the Connect to Oracle dialog box. I am using AWS DMS tool for migrating from Oracle to PostgreSQL. Potential post-migration challenges to account for. Organizations migrating their database systems must meet many challenges that are technical and time-consuming. 2016-06-22OracletoPostgresMigration-part2 Starting and Connecting • pg_ctl is your friend (put this line in /etc/rc.local and make it executable): • psql is the universal client: su - pg95 -c 'bin/pg_ctl -D data -l log start' [root@p0-primary ~]# su - pg95 Last login: Wed Jun 22 08:47:36 UTC 2016 on pts/0 [pg95@p0-primary ~]$ bin/psql . Build a business case for your Amazon migration by defining your objectives. AWS Snowball Edge is an AWS service that provides an Edge device that you can use to transfer data to the cloud at faster-than-network speeds. This overview is by no means an exhaustive, however these are common challenges you may encounter when administering PostgreSQL after a background with Oracle. According to Gartner, "By 2022, more than 70 percent of new in-house applications will be developed on an open-source database management system (OSDBMS), and 50 percent of existing commercial relational database management system (RDBMS . AWS DMS performs well for homogenous migrations, but when it comes to migrating heterogeneous databases (where the source and target database engines are different), such as migrating from Oracle to Postgres, or Postgres to Microsoft SQL Server or MySQL, using only DMS will not be sufficient. This method involves manually configuring the PostgreSQL ODBC driver to set up Oracle to PostgreSQL Migration. AWS has rich set of tools and documentation that makes database migration process easier, faster and effective. There can be many reasons for this: The fact that I only pay attention to things that result in errors during migration. . Tools can provide invaluable time-saving capabilities for different aspects of migration. Amazon and Salesforce may leave Oracle by 2020 and 2023, setting a new precedence for Oracle migration Migrating from SQL Server to PostgreSQL Migrating from PostgreSQL to Sql Server Marc covers getting started, migration When facing analytical challenges, SAS Viya is the best tool for visualization of . job type: Contract. Since there were challenges to migrate some of the schemas like procedures . IBM - 5.6%. 1. In Redshift, you do not get these procedural constructs. The schema will be converted and shown on the PostgreSQL instance (it has not been applied yet). Migrate the entire database using Data Migration tools (AWS DMS) from Oracle to Postgresql. Tackle database migration with these initial steps. "Migrating a database to the cloud can be a complex process, especially between heterogeneous database engines like Oracle and PostgreSQL. Note: This is not an issue for apps that you control and have the source . Method 2: Using Hevo to Set up Oracle to PostgreSQL Migration Hevo provides a hassle-free solution and helps you directly transfer data from Oracle to PostgreSQL without any intervention in an effortless manner. . How a Datavail client saved thousands of dollars in licensing fees per year by migrating from Oracle to PostgreSQL, plus a few other wins. PostgreSQL is one of the most popular open-source relational database systems. Enterprises are right to be cautious. AWS provides two managed PostgreSQL options: Amazon RDS and Amazon Aurora. Deciding whether to migrate database platforms . Still, Oracle is suitable for huge data and workload. Full convert. below is the Error for your reference. Phase 1: Migration Preparation and Business Planning. This applies to the stored procedures, packages, and functions within the database and the application code that reads and writes to the database. However, organizations are migrating from Oracle and adopting PostgreSQL as their open-source alternative. I had converted 823 table out of 866 tables to postgres. Indeed, one of the most commonly cited challenges when migrating from Oracle to PostgreSQL is the difficulty involved in preparing engineering teams for the migration. However, AWS Schema Conversion Tool (SCT) helps to migrate at ease. Learn how to convert and migrate your relational databases, nonrelational databases, and data warehouses to the cloud. Our past experience in AWS Database migration service for many large-scale enterprises have helped us to foresee challenges and equip us to frame an error-free migration . While PostgreSQL is a solid choice for migration from Oracle, many businesses have trouble getting such a migration project off the ground. This requires systematic mapping and checking. The challenge, of course, is how to migrate your database from Oracle to PostgreSQL. AWS Schema Conversion Tool . Some of the most significant reasons are high Oracle licensing cost, AWS PostgreSQL flexibility, . Ora2Pg is the most popular tool for converting / migrating Oracle database to PostgreSQL. Using non-intrusive change data capture (CDC), Striim enables continuous data ingestion from Oracle to Postgres with sub-second latency. monthly hotel rates in st augustine, fl; directors guild of america training program This section discusses some of the differences between Oracle and PostgreSQL to illustrate opportunities and challenges with migrating an Oracle application. . Conclusion. Migration requires a hands-on approach. There are various aspects you need to take . We are planning to migrate our PRPC systems from Oracle to Postgresql. Given the 50% discount assumption, the annual support fees for Oracle software in our r4.4xlarge instance would be $62,920. By default, AWS DMS uses Oracle LogMiner to capture changes. 14. Users can easily set up ingestion via Striim's pre-configured CDC wizards, and drag-and-drop UI. Oracle is the #1 legacy database, and its extremely onerous license policies are driving the majority of migration demand. education: Bachelors. Knowledge of AWS database migration software and technologies. It is considered to be one of the top database choices when customers migrate from commercial databases such as Oracle and Microsoft SQL Server. The Oracle NumToDSInterval function is responsible for the conversion of the provided number value of specified time units or expressions to an . An Oracle to PostgreSQL relocation in the AWS Cloud can be an intricate multistage process with various advances and abilities included, beginning from the appraisal stage to the cutover organize. So at the source I have a column with datatype varchar2 (4000), where I have something stored like this: This will be my first time visiting Seattle. EDB Supercharges PostgreSQL. When I am trying to migrate this . To start off heterogeneous migrations between different database platforms are never easy. Enter a project name and a location to save your project. Answer: Lack of procedural constructs: Oracle has a very strong PL/ SQL component tagged to its servers and if you have used Oracle over a period of time, there is a good chance that you use procedures in Oracle. Barrio main menu. Select File, and then select New Project. There are dedicated Oracle to PostgreSQL migration tools that help move database objects, definitions, indexes in minutes. If you move to our offering, you'll also benefit from fully offloading this area of your data infrastructure. Use Cases. 1. PostgreSQL also clearly has the edge when it comes to compatibility with operating . Ora_migrator — an extension that uses an oracle_fdw foreign data wrapper to extract data from an Oracle database. CYBERTEC offers comprehensive services to move from Oracle to PostgreSQL. Coupling this with migrating the database to the cloud definitely adds on to the challenge. This quick-start migration guide will get you rapidly moving in the right direction. Steps: Connect to the source database i.e. Then, the data is copied via DMS. Next, copy the output.sql file to your PostgreSQL database server, and run it, using this command: psql soe soe -f output.sql. Note: This is not an issue for apps that you control and have the source . With a constant stream of innovations reflected in annual releases, Postgres has achieved three major database of the year awards from DBengines.com, recognition This flow chart shows you the steps to move an Oracle database to either a PostgreSQL or a SQL database in Azure. Reason Seven: Better Handling of Massive Amounts of Data. responsibilities: Prior experience of migrating from Oracle 19C (on premise/cloud) to PostgreSQL AWS. What is the best approach to migrate our PRPC systems from Oracle to Postgresql. The first edition of the playbook covers Oracle-to-Aurora migrations. Migrating bigger size large objects can be expensive . The initial challenge is to analyze the application and database object, find out the incompatibilities between Oracle and PostgreSQL and estimate the time and cost required for migration. So to run ora2pg, after setting up the ora2pg.conf command, just enter ora2pg. Select source as Oracle DB and target PostgreSQL Choose which schema needs migration by selecting the name Right-click the schema name and select "Convert Schema" Then select "Assessment Report View" The report shows a summary of the efforts required to convert the Oracle database to PostgreSQL. The first step is to convert the database schema with the AWS Schema Conversion Tool (SCT). Oracle's market share is declining, while Google Cloud's is rising. AWS SCT - There are various data migration object challenges during the migration process. Enterprise tool quickly copies DB2 database to PostgreSQL. One of the AWS blog covers many scenarios of validating schema objects between Oracle (source) and PostgreSQL (target) after Oracle database schema objects are converted into PostgreSQL object types and migrated. However, there is a common challenge with implementing the Oracle NumToDSInterval function in PostgreSQL. Ora2pg is THE OPTION if you are intending to migrate the data from Oracle database to PostgreSQL. How a Datavail client saved thousands of dollars in licensing fees per year by migrating from Oracle to PostgreSQL, plus a few other wins. Here are some tips to follow when you're migrating from Oracle to PostgreSQL: If you have packaged applications or if you want to move your commercial ERP/CRM/accounting application from Oracle to Postgres, make sure that your vendor offers certification on PostgreSQL. AWS - 23.9%. . Oracle Migration; Hybrid Cloud; High Availability; Solutions for Training your team to be familiar with PostgreSQL Optional: Choose the tables that you want to convert (by default all the tables selected) Start the conversion. Architecture & Services - we built the architecture, framework and selected the AWS services and open source tools. defsfile ./dirdef/andy.def, purge. userid ggadmin, password ggadmin. Open SSMA for Oracle. AWS DMS migrates your data from your Oracle source into your PostgreSQL target. Fill out the form to download the white paper and take the first step to an open-source database migration. MySQL, MariaDB, and PostgreSQL are some of the popular choices when it comes to migrating to open source. There are two main methods to run Oracle on AWS. 6 Simple Steps to Oracle to PostgreSQL Migration. Challenges in using DMS to migrate Jira and Confluence from Oracle to Amazon RDS Postgres The first step in the migration process was to convert the schema from the Oracle database to PostgreSQL. Deciding whether to migrate database platforms . The challenge Oracle's subtype declaration allows creating an "alias" for some datatype declaration, which can be re-used later as many times as needed. The most intensive effort during an Oracle-to-PostgreSQL migration is usually porting the code to work with PostgreSQL. Oracle to Postgres Migration - part 1 by PgTraining 1716 views. Oracle acquired LogFire in 2016 as the foundation for Oracle Warehouse Management. Oracle - 20.6%. 2. PDF. By default, many DBAs pick the numeric data type in PostgreSQL over smallint, integer, bigint for converting all number columns in Oracle. Oracle databases available on-premises, on AWS, and Oracle databases on Azure. salary: $65 - 72 per hour. This pattern describes how you can migrate an on-premises Oracle database to Amazon Relational Database Service (Amazon RDS) for PostgreSQL, using AWS Database Migration Service (AWS DMS) to migrate the data, AWS Schema Conversion Tool (AWS SCT) to convert the database schema, and an Oracle bystander to help manage the migration. Install Pega Base Product on Postgresql and then extract the custom code as RAP and install on top of base product. Here, we explain the key reasons why companies are considering migrating from Oracle to PostgreSQL: Scalability: You can use Oracle for a high workload. AWS Database Migration Service (AWS DMS) and AWS Schema Conversion Tool (AWS SCT) can help with homogeneous migrations as well as migrations between different database engines, such as Oracle or SQL Server, to Amazon Aurora. The Checklist: Oracle to PostgreSQL Migration Before getting started, it's important to understand that no tool that can automate the process completely. PostgreSQL has the following limits for dealing with data store: Limit. We help our clients capitalize on cloud migration projects as a great . In conjunction with the annual, on-demand cost for an r4.4xlarge instance of $9,320.64, we can arrive at an annual compute+software cost of $72,240.64 for the Oracle EC2 instance. *; From the OS level, generate the defgen file. When you're connected, select the name of the schema that you want to migrate on the left side. With Amazon DMS, one can perform both homogenous and heterogenous data migrations, from on-premises or Amazon RDS, with Amazon RDS as a target. Use Oracle script artifacts to evaluate Oracle database. location: Tampa, Florida. Right-click the schema name and choose Convert Schema. wrapper. These are the same steps as used to create the defgen file for MySQL: This allows GoldenGate to translate the Oracle definition to the PostgreSQL definition. When you start the application, you need to create a new project, with the source being Oracle and the target being PostgreSQL. Additionally, we've witnessed that many of clients are reluctant to become further entangled with Oracle in their move to the cloud. Right click on the created schema on the right and click "Apply to database". PostgreSQL domains entirely differ from Oracle's subtypes. Install Pega Base Product on Postgresql and then extract the custom code as RAP and install on top of base product. Oracle Migration To Challenges Postgresql. To continue innovating and modernizing logistics, Oracle Warehouse Management had to add new . 3. We'll manage your PostgreSQL deployment in the cloud so you can focus on other areas of innovation. When you perform a migration from Oracle to PostgreSQL, we suggest that you supply certain transformation rules under your task's table-mapping . There are three stages on assessments such as the architectural assessment, schema assessment and application code assessment. The legacy databases like MS SQL and Oracle DB are still running from Rackspace and enterprises feel the need to transform to AWS compatible databases like Aurora PostgreSQL. 1. Oracle to PostgreSQL: Technical quick guide. Why EDB? PostgreSQL is a row-oriented database, but it has the capability to store large amount of data. Database code PostgreSQL is similar to Oracle in many ways. Method 1: Manual Oracle to PostgreSQL Migration. directly in the database. PostgreSQL RDBMS are not designed to handle analytical and data warehousing workloads. AWS DMS also captures data manipulation language (DML) and supported data definition language (DDL) changes that happen on your source database and applies these changes to your target database. Schema conversion is different for both . ERROR: function aws_oracle_ext.systimestamp () does not exist Postgres is the logical target for the migrations. AWS SCT provides functionalities for the most efficient migration from Oracle to PostgreSQL. Database migration to Aurora - Oracle to Amazon PostgreSQL-Aurora in the life sciences Interact is a healthcare software company that has dedicated itself to using technology and behavioural science to bring the wide and effective use of digital technology into helping patients within specialist medicine. There is a lot of interest these days in migrating data from commercial relational databases to open-source relational databases. Migrate the entire database using Data Migration tools (AWS DMS) from Oracle to Postgresql. Migrating LOBs from Oracle 12c. The conversion of DB2 to PostgreSQL database using Full Convert tool is very simple. Compatibility - PostgreSQL. But with the rise of open source databases, Oracle database popularity has been declining steadily, around 18% since 2013. So, you will have to come a. The Challenges to Migration and How to Overcome Them. DB2. a. Oracle has a robust language in PL/SQL, however PostgreSQL allows you to write language handlers in multiple languages (Python, R, etc.) AWS Database Migration Service (AWS DMS) can use AWS Snowball Edge and Amazon S3 to migrate large databases more quickly than by other methods. Fill out the form to download the white paper and take the first step to an open-source database migration. GGSCI@pgorcl>edit params defgen. You can use AWS Database Migration Service (AWS DMS) to migrate your data to and from most widely used commercial and open-source databases such as Oracle, PostgreSQL, Microsoft SQL Server, Amazon Redshift, Amazon Aurora, MariaDB, and MySQL. We'll look into conversion of Oracle "aliases". Answer: AWS has launched a very good tool named Schema Conversion Tool which can help convert the Oracle schema into PostgreSQL schema. We want to help you to move to PostgreSQL faster. Ora2pg — a robust migration tool that connects to an Oracle database, extracts schemas and tables and generates SQL scripts that can be loaded into Postgres. 2. Google Cloud - 6.5%. Typically, about 70-75% of our clients workloads can move without significant effort when using the tools and skills available through EDB. Then select Azure SQL Database as the migration target from the drop-down list and select OK. work hours: 8am to 4pm. About Oracle To Postgresql Challenges Migration . BEDFORD, Mass.--(BUSINESS WIRE)--EDB, the world leader in accelerating Postgres® in the enterprise, announced the general availability of EDB BigAnimal™ on Amazon Web Services (AWS), in addition to its current availability on Microsoft Azure. Moving and processing data in-flight, Striim filters data that is not required and delivers what is important . table andy. Then choose View / Assessment Report View. AWS DMS can use two methods to capture changes to an Oracle database, Binary Reader and Oracle LogMiner. In this session, w. We were using AWS SCT build #660 to convert one of our Oracle test databases. Methods to Set up Oracle to PostgreSQL Migration.

a violent separation ending explained 2022